Hi
Been waiting to upload a few pictures,but had to wait to get my Tudor back from Rolex after a service.Its nearly 10 years old,I cannot believe how mint it has come back.I had new glass and a new bezel fitted,it looks like a new watch.
The other is my date just.
These are the only two I have at the moment,I really like these two watches and dont really crave anything else,I just love the oyster bracelet with a white dial.
Thanks for looking.
